The original (remanufactured) starter motors had a wide tolerance. I had one that was too short. The new starter motors made in India have a much better tolerance. Try http://www.injoy-1.com/catal_sail.htm

If it is not much, put it in a lathe or drill press and use some Crocus Cloth to work it down a bit.
